How Common Is The Last Name de Guerra? popularity and diffusion

The last name de Guerra is the 1,369,340th most numerous surname worldwide. It is borne by around 1 in 45,264,260 people. It occurs mostly in The Americas, where 58 percent of de Guerra reside; 35 percent reside in Southeast Asia and 35 percent reside in Fil-Southeast Asia. It is also the 2,036,353rd most commonly occurring first name globally, borne by 27 people.

The last name is most commonly held in The Philippines, where it is carried by 57 people, or 1 in 1,776,109. In The Philippines it is mostly found in: Mimaropa, where 30 percent are found, National Capital Region, where 30 percent are found and Western Visayas, where 19 percent are found. Excluding The Philippines de Guerra occurs in 16 countries. It is also common in Brazil, where 18 percent are found and The Dominican Republic, where 14 percent are found.
